The property is a detached, extended cottage with brick and part tile-hung elevations under a tiled roof and accommodation over two floors. The layout can be seen in the floorplan but of particular note is the kitchen/breakfast room with matching floor and wall mounted units and being in the heart of the house with three reception rooms leading off. There are two main reception rooms, both with open fires and a separate study. The stairs rise to the first floor landing, off which are five bedrooms and a family bathroom. Two of the bedrooms have their own en suite facilities. Outside, the house is approached by a gravel drive with ample parking. The garden is mainly laid to lawn with a variety of mature borders and is enclosed by deer fencing. There is a detached brick built outbuilding which has been a former annexe but now requires a bit of attention. There is also a separate detached garage. In all, the property lies in a plot of approximately 0.66 acre.

Location:
The property is situated in a tucked away spot, in the hamlet of Langley, to the north-east of Liss. Liss boasts its own train station to London (Waterloo) and a variety of local amenities including shops, pubs, churches and schools. Petersfield lies to the south and offers more extensive amenities in a bustling town centre. Shops include Waitrose, M&S Food, Tesco and there are numerous boutiques, cafes and further shops. The town has many active clubs and societies with golf available at Petersfield and Liphook, horse and motor racing at Goodwood, polo at Cowdray Park and sailing along the South Coast. There are many popular schools in the area including Churcher's College, Bedales, Ditcham Park, Bohunt and The Petersfield School (TPS).

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on May 20,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on May 20,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
